Job Description

● Supervise and coordinate the execution of well intervention activities (including but not limited to Well testing, stimulation, logging, slackline, coiled tubing, gas lift valve change, fishing, perforation, BPV installation/retrieval, wellhead maintenance, and any other wells-related activities). ● Prepare and review well intervention programs. ● Check the integrity of sub-contractor-supplied equipment, tools, and materials. ● Ensure safe and efficient execution of operations by sub-contractors. ● Scrutinize daily operation reports from the well services sub-contractor and send them out. ● Ensure data management of well operations activities in collaboration with RE dept. ● Partake in after-action reviews of good activities. ● Prepare periodical reports of the department (weekly, monthly, and annual) ● Organize and report after-action reviews of good activities. ● Direct well control in the event of any abnormal or emergency situations arising from the well operations. ● Partake in well and facility performance reviews to generate and propose production enhancement initiatives. ● Verify subcontractors' service tickets and invoices and collaborate in contract management. ● Act as contract holder in accordance with SIPC Iran contract management policy and procedure if applicable. ● Collect, quality check (QA/QC), validate site raw data then distribute out. ● Prepare operation summary reports, a quality check of all Subcontractor’s summary reports then submits them to clients. ● Collaborate in well and gas lifting performance monitoring and troubleshooting and contribute to well service operation program. ● Ensure maximum production capacity through optimization of good intervention and stimulation operations. ● Aid completion/work over-engineer for optimization and designing of completion string and artificial lift systems. ● Collaborate with chemical engineers for the provision of chemicals and materials and optimization of chemical injection. ● Assist in preparing Work Program and Budget (WPB). ● Support preparing long-term forecasts, annual development strategies, and production plans and programs.

Requirements

● At least a Bachelor's degree in Petroleum Engineering. ● At least 10 years of experience in well operation in the Oil industry; at least 5 years in a supervisory position with a proven track record. ● Valid IWCF/other Well control accreditations. ● Knowledge of Well completion and intervention operation and equipment (coiled tubing, slackline, well testing, stimulation, logging, gas lift system, perforation, wellhead, and X-mas tree). ● Knowledge of Well services contracts. ● Knowledge of the practical application of petroleum engineering science and technology, including applying principles, techniques, procedures, and equipment to the design and perform operational activities. Technology skills: ● Computer literacy. ● Microsoft Office. ● Oilfield management. ● Well modeling software (PROSPER, and PIPESIM). ● Well test analysis software (Kappa Saphir, Pan System, FAST, etc.). ● Stimulation design software (Stim CADE, Stim Pro, Well Book, etc.). ● Fluent in English as the official language of the company.
